The cool parts - the parts that have won Dubai its reputation as ’the Vegas of the Middle East’ or ’the Venice of the Middle East’ or ’the Disney World of the Middle East, if Disney World were the size of San Francisco and out in a desert’ - have been built in the last ten years.

George Saunders

Interpretation

Saunders’s sentence uses a piling-up of nicknames—each a Western, entertainment-driven analogy—to capture Dubai’s deliberately manufactured spectacle. By calling these attractions “the cool parts” and stressing that they were built “in the last ten years,” he highlights the city’s extreme recentness and the speed with which capital can fabricate an image of glamour in an inhospitable setting. The parenthetical “if Disney World were the size of San Francisco and out in a desert” sharpens the satire: the scale is both impressive and faintly absurd, suggesting a theme common in Saunders’s nonfiction—unease about consumer fantasy, boosterish rhetoric, and the human costs or hollowness that may underlie dazzling surfaces.
